![]() ![]() A small subsample of my data is: w <- structure(list(Var1 = structure(c(1L, 2L, 1L, 2L, 1L, 2L, 1L,ĢL). ![]() ![]() When I run my code I don't get any errors or warnings (which I know doesn't always mean everything is working like I think it is), but instead of my predefined labels being applied to the plots I just get "NA" as the plot label. I'm trying to use the labeller function within ggplot2 to label faceted plots. Use geom_autopoint for scale-based jitter ggplot ( mpg ) geom_autopoint ( ) facet_matrix ( vars ( drv : fl ) ) # Have a special diagonal layer ggplot ( mpg ) geom_autopoint ( ) geom_autodensity ( ) facet_matrix ( vars ( drv : fl ), layer.diag = 2 ) # \donttest # Make asymmetric grid ggplot ( mpg ) geom_boxplot ( aes (x =. panel_y ) ) facet_matrix ( vars ( displ, cty, hwy ), flip.rows = TRUE, alternate.axes = TRUE, switch = 'both' ) theme (strip.background = element_blank ( ), acement = 'outside', strip.text = element_text (size = 12 ) ) # Mix discrete and continuous columns. panel_y ) ) facet_matrix ( vars ( displ, cty, hwy ) ) # Switch the diagonal, alternate the axes and style strips as axis labels ggplot ( mpg ) geom_point ( aes (x =. # Standard use: ggplot ( mpg ) geom_point ( aes (x =. Situations the diagonal are used to plot the distribution of the column dataĪnd will thus not use the y-scale. Should the y grid be removed from the diagonal? In certain Unlike the position based specifications above these also have an effect in ![]() Panels have both a discrete x and y axis, and mixed panels have one of each. Continuous panels have both a continuous x and y axis, discrete Referencing panel positions it references the combination of position scales Settings will only have an effect if the grid is symmetric. That position, and using FALSE will conversely remove all layers. Will make the second layer appear on the diagonal as well as remove that Specified directly to appear at that position. The default ( NULL) will allow any layer that has not been Should axes be drawn at alternating positions. Rows and columns are equal, the diagonal goes from bottom-left to top-right Should the order of the rows be reversed so that, if the label_value() is used by default,Ĭheck it for more details and pointers to other options. You can use different labelingįunctions for different kind of labels, for example use label_parsed() forįormatting facet labels. This function should inherit from the "labeller" S3 classįor compatibility with labeller(). Thus there will be more thanĬolumn gets displayed as one separate line in the strip Each inputĬolumn corresponds to one factor. Returns a list or data frame of character vectors. Can also be set toĪ function that takes one data frame of labels and If "x", the top labels will beĭisplayed to the bottom. If FALSE, will be range of raw dataīy default, the labels are displayed on the top and If TRUE, will shrink scales to fit output of These data values will be made available to the different They are specified using the ggplot2::vars()įunction wherein you can use standard tidyselect syntax as known from e.g.ĭplyr::select(). A specification of the data columns to put in the rows andĬolumns of the facet grid.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|